Lessons in Chemistry by Bonnie Garmus
Discover an inspiring story of intelligence, ambition, and resilience with Lessons in Chemistry by Bonnie Garmus, a bestselling novel that combines humor, science, and social commentary.
Set in the 1960s, the story follows Elizabeth Zott, a talented chemist whose scientific career is limited by the expectations placed on women during that era. When she becomes the host of a popular cooking television show, she uses her platform to challenge stereotypes and encourage women to pursue knowledge, independence, and confidence.
With unforgettable characters, sharp humor, and an empowering message, Lessons in Chemistry celebrates curiosity, determination, and breaking barriers.
